Cash administration developments on social media come and go – however the newest buzzword to seize individuals’s creativeness might be fairly helpful.

We’re speaking about ‘loud budgeting’, which has apparently been gathering concentrate on TikTok – the hashtag #loudbudgeting has some 12.8 million views and counting. So, what does it imply, and will it really prevent cash?

What’s loud budgeting?

Reasonably than quietly fretting over your funds when your mates invite you to a social occasion, loud budgeting is all about being open and clear with others about your cash scenario. Primarily, it frees individuals from smiling politely throughout an evening out, whereas anxiously watching their cash rapidly evaporate on their banking app.

Some individuals might really feel extra comfy being vocal about cash than others, nonetheless. Apparently, a latest survey by credit score administration firm Lowell indicated males (31%) have been extra prone to really feel comfy speaking about their monetary scenario than girls (19%) total.

What when you’re anxious about falling out with buddies?

Some family and friends members might initially really feel a bit put out when you flip down an invitation for an evening out, or maybe one thing costlier corresponding to a vacation. However they’re extra prone to be understanding when you clearly clarify to them why it’s worthwhile to get monetary savings, or can’t afford it proper now.

Maybe you could have long-term targets, corresponding to paying off money owed or getting on the property ladder, which can be extremely necessary to you. Additionally, many individuals are feeling the pinch as a result of cost-of-living disaster, so persons are prone to sympathise when you clarify that it’s worthwhile to follow your price range.

May there be compromises?

It doesn’t must be a case of all-or-nothing, both. Maybe as an alternative of reserving a weekend break in a fancy resort, for instance, you would go for a staycation with self-catering. Or quite than an enormous night time out, you would get a takeaway with buddies. So long as you’re all collectively, you’ll be having fun with yourselves. It’s all about normalising having a dialog about what you’ll be able to and might’t afford.

How can I follow my cash targets?

It’s value making use of free on-line budgeting instruments and banking app instruments to assist hold monitor of the place your cash goes too, and reduce the danger of impulse buys getting in the best way of long run targets.

In the event you’re saving for one thing specifically, corresponding to a vacation or a automobile, doing a lot of analysis into your objective might assist to focus your thoughts on the last word prize and forestall you from being distracted.

Often checking your financial savings pot also can provide you with a way of accomplishment that you just’re shifting nearer to your objective. And as your saving technique pays off, who is aware of, perhaps your family and friends members can even really feel impressed to do the identical.
